Abstract The report analyzes the cost-effectiveness of two alternative regulatory options: A Treated Discharge Option and a Zero Discharge Option. The report compares the total annualized cost incurred for each of the two regulatory options to the corresponding effectiveness of that option in reducing the discharge of pollutants. The effectiveness measure used is poinds of pollutant removed weighted by an estimate of the relative toxicity of the pollutant. The study discusses the cost-effectiveness methodology employed in the report including the pollutants included in the analysis and the toxic weighting factors. The report lists the pesticide active ingredients (PAIs) proposed for regulation. Also included are details regarding pesticide manufacturing facilities which are excluded from the cost-effectiveness analysis and a sensitivity analysis of POTW removal efficiencies.
